Furniture design software is not a single market — it is three distinct ones. Production CAD with CNC output, visual planners for kitchen studios, and 3D visualisation tools each solve a different problem. Confusing them is one of the most common reasons people end up with the wrong software.

Three classes of software — three different jobs

ClassFor whomPrimary job
Production CADFurniture manufacturersParametric design → cut list → CNC → bill of materials
Kitchen plannerStudios, dealers, retailersFast visual configuration and sales
VisualisationDesigners, marketing teamsPhotorealistic renders, client presentations

Production CAD for furniture

This class of software is the backbone of a furniture factory. It enables parametric design, automatic cut optimisation, CNC machine programs, and a full bill of materials. Getting this choice wrong costs real money — the right software defines how efficient the entire workshop is.

IMOS iX (Germany)

One of the most powerful and widely deployed production CAD systems in Europe. Built on top of AutoCAD, it adds a full parametric furniture layer over a proven 2D and 3D drafting engine.

  • Full cycle: design → cut list → CNC programs → BOM specification
  • Deep ERP integration (SAP, Microsoft Dynamics and others)
  • Native data exchange with leading CNC machine manufacturers
  • Dominant in the DACH region (Germany, Austria, Switzerland) and Benelux
  • Supports both cabinet furniture and solid wood construction
  • Price: subscription plus a significant setup fee, enterprise tier

Cabinet Vision (USA / UK)

The industry standard in North America and at large UK manufacturers. Owned by Hexagon. Covers the entire production cycle from design through to CNC output.

  • Powerful cabinet editor with parametric components
  • Built-in cut optimisation module and CNC program generator
  • Photorealistic visualisation included in the base package
  • Strong ecosystem: training, certification, large user community
  • Popular in the USA, Canada, UK, and Australia
  • Price: mid-to-high subscription tier

Polyboard (UK)

Affordable production CAD from Wood Engine Ltd. The go-to choice for small and medium workshops in Europe that need professional tools without an enterprise budget.

  • Parametric cabinet design
  • Automatic cut optimisation and sheet layout reports
  • Integration with common CNC post-processors
  • Simpler interface than IMOS or Cabinet Vision
  • Subscription significantly cheaper than the competition
  • Popular in the UK, Ireland, France, and Eastern Europe

Mozaik (USA)

An American program gaining traction as an accessible alternative to Cabinet Vision. A good fit for custom shops in North America.

  • Parametric design for cabinets and kitchen units
  • Built-in cut optimisation
  • Approachable interface, short learning curve
  • Active user base, good documentation
  • Price: lower than Cabinet Vision, subscription model

Topsolid Wood (France)

A French product from Missler Software. Covers both cabinet furniture and solid wood manufacturing. Strong in France, Belgium, Spain, and several other EU countries.

  • Full 3D CAD with a parametric woodworking module
  • Solid wood construction support, including complex joinery
  • Tight integration with Topsolid CAM for CNC
  • De facto standard in France for medium and large manufacturers
  • Price: enterprise tier, requires implementation and training

Microvellum (USA)

Runs on top of Autodesk Inventor. Deep parametrics, strong CNC output. Popular with large American manufacturers that need flexible customisation.

  • Built on Autodesk Inventor — a powerful 3D platform
  • Advanced parametric engine, supports non-standard constructions
  • Full CNC output and integration with production systems
  • Requires proficiency in Inventor — high barrier to entry
  • Price: high, predominantly North American market

If your factory works with European equipment, ask the machine supplier which software their post-processor is configured for. This often narrows the choice to two or three options without additional development work.

The Russian and CIS market

The Russian and CIS furniture market has developed its own software ecosystem. These programs are historically easier to learn, significantly cheaper than Western equivalents, and adapted to local documentation standards.

PRO100

The most widely used furniture program in Russia and the CIS. Originally developed in Ukraine/Belarus, now owned by a European company. A straightforward 3D cabinet builder with a library of standard carcasses and materials.

  • Massive user base — hundreds of thousands of users across the CIS
  • Fast onboarding — usable within a few hours of starting
  • Built-in visualisation, material and hardware libraries
  • Basic cut list and specification export
  • Technology is dated: no parametrics, limited CNC output
  • Price: low, free demo version available

KD Max

A Russian program for designing and visualising kitchens, sliding-door wardrobes, and walk-in closets. The main emphasis is on a high-quality 3D result and a large texture and facade library.

  • High visualisation quality for a Russian-market product
  • Large library of materials, facades, and hardware
  • Tools for kitchens, wardrobes, and dressing rooms
  • Specification and cut list export
  • More sales-oriented than production-oriented
  • Price: mid-range by Russian-market standards

Bazis-Mebelshchik

A Russian production-oriented CAD. Unlike PRO100, it is built for the engineer and process technologist rather than the salesperson.

  • Parametric cabinet furniture design
  • Technical documentation generation to GOST standards
  • Cut optimisation and CNC export
  • Advanced tools for the technologist: drilling patterns, detailed specifications
  • Used at medium and large Russian manufacturing plants
  • Price: mid-range, significantly below Western equivalents

Kitchen planners for studios and retail

This class is built for sales, not production. The goal is to show the customer quickly and visually how a kitchen or living room will look, and to generate a quote. Production documentation is absent or minimal.

Winner Design / Cyncly (Scandinavia / EU)

Winner Design was created by Norwegian company Compusoft. It is now part of Cyncly — the largest software holding in the interior design industry, formed from the merger of Compusoft and 2020 Technologies.

  • De facto standard in the UK, Scandinavia, Germany, and Benelux for kitchen studios
  • Catalogues of major European kitchen manufacturers built into the software
  • High-quality built-in visualisation
  • Fast generation of quotes and specifications
  • Cloud architecture with automatic catalogue updates
  • Price: subscription, aimed at the professional market

2020 Design Live (USA / EU)

Also part of Cyncly. Historically stronger in North America but widely used in Europe too. Specialises in kitchens, bathrooms, and cabinetry.

  • Huge catalogue library (predominantly American and European manufacturers)
  • Photorealistic render tools without leaving the program
  • Client-facing tools: presentations and VR walk-throughs
  • Deep integration with CRM and retail systems
  • Popular in the USA, Canada, and parts of Europe

3D visualisation and rendering

Visualisation software is used wherever photorealistic images are needed: marketing materials, product catalogues, designer portfolios. This is a separate world — you are not designing furniture in a technical sense, you are showing how it looks.

3ds Max + V-Ray / Corona Renderer (global standard)

The industry standard for professional furniture and interior visualisation. The 3ds Max + V-Ray or Corona combination is used by most architecture studios and furniture manufacturers for their catalogues.

  • Top-tier photorealistic rendering quality
  • Vast library of materials and ready-made 3D models (CGaxis, Evermotion, etc.)
  • Steep learning curve — expect several months to a year to become proficient
  • Cost: 3ds Max (~$285/mo) + V-Ray or Corona ($300–600/year)
  • The standard behind catalogues for IKEA, Poliform, Minotti and most major European furniture brands

Blender (open source, free)

A free professional 3D application. Over the last five years Blender has grown to the point where major studios use it. An active furniture community, good add-ons, continuous development.

  • Completely free — no subscription, no licence fee
  • Built-in Cycles renderer — photorealistic quality
  • Eevee — real-time rendering for quick previews
  • Large community: extensive tutorials, add-ons, and asset libraries
  • Used by professional visualisation studios alongside 3ds Max
  • Steeper initial learning curve than purpose-built tools

SketchUp + Enscape / V-Ray (global)

SketchUp is a fast and intuitive 3D modeller. On its own it does not produce photorealistic output, but paired with Enscape or V-Ray for SketchUp it becomes a powerful tool for architects and furniture designers.

  • Fast modelling, approachable interface, low barrier to entry
  • 3D Warehouse — a free catalogue of millions of furniture 3D models
  • Enscape: real-time rendering inside SketchUp, VR walk-through
  • V-Ray for SketchUp: offline photorealistic rendering
  • Widely used by interior designers across the EU
  • SketchUp Pro: ~$349/year; Enscape: ~$860/year

KeyShot (global)

A specialist renderer for product visualisation. Popular with furniture manufacturers for catalogue shoots without a photo studio — especially for individual pieces and hardware components.

  • Minimal pipeline: import 3D model → assign materials → render
  • Among the best engines for rendering individual objects and product groups
  • Extensive material library: wood, metal, fabric, glass, lacquer
  • Used by Blum, Häfele, and other hardware manufacturers for their catalogues
  • Price: from $995/year

Enscape (plugin for SketchUp / Revit / Rhino)

Real-time rendering without export or conversion. The designer sees the final result while working. The fastest way to produce quality visualisation without deep rendering knowledge.

  • Works as a plugin: SketchUp, Revit, Rhino, Archicad
  • Real-time rendering — changes visible immediately
  • Built-in VR: walk through the interior in a headset, directly from the program
  • Panoramic renders for sharing with clients
  • Price: ~$860/year (single licence)

General-purpose CAD adapted for furniture

Some programs were not designed specifically for furniture but are widely used in the industry — especially where precise 3D geometry for CNC is needed or where solid wood joinery must be modelled exactly.

Autodesk Fusion 360

Cloud-based CAD/CAM from Autodesk. Free for start-ups and small businesses. Lets you model a furniture component to 0.01 mm and immediately generate G-code for a CNC router.

  • Parametric 3D modelling of any complexity
  • Built-in CAM module: toolpaths for 3-axis and 5-axis CNC
  • Machining simulation and collision checking
  • Free for small businesses (under $100k revenue), $680/year for commercial use
  • No automatic sheet cut optimisation without add-ons
  • Ideal for bespoke pieces: curved facades, carved elements, one-off designs

SolidWorks + SWOOD

SWOOD is a plugin by French company Eficad that turns SolidWorks into a dedicated furniture CAD. Mainly used at larger European manufacturers where SolidWorks is already deployed.

  • Powerful parametric CAD plus SWOOD furniture libraries
  • Full production cycle: cut list, CNC, specifications
  • Solid wood construction and complex assembly support
  • Popular in France, Belgium, Switzerland, and Spain
  • High cost: SolidWorks licence plus SWOOD subscription

AutoCAD

The classic 2D CAD. In furniture it is used mainly for shop drawings, layout plans, and technical documentation. 3D in AutoCAD is possible but lags well behind purpose-built solutions.

  • The standard for technical documentation in construction and furniture
  • Powerful 2D draughting tools, annotation, dimensioning
  • Furniture blocks and floor plans — a standard AutoCAD task
  • No automatic cut optimisation or furniture specifications without plugins
  • Price: ~$255/mo (included in Autodesk AEC and Industry packages)

How to choose for your situation

  • Small workshop in the EU → Polyboard: affordable, professional CNC output, no ERP needed
  • Large manufacturer in Germany or Austria → IMOS iX: the DACH market standard, best integration with German machinery
  • Manufacturer in France → Topsolid Wood or IMOS iX: both have local support and implementation partners
  • Kitchen studio or showroom in the EU → Winner Design / Cyncly: major manufacturer catalogues are already built in
  • Kitchen studio in the USA → 2020 Design Live or Cabinet Vision Retail
  • Small workshop in Russia or CIS → PRO100 (fast start) or Bazis-Mebelshchik (if proper CNC output is needed)
  • Marketing visualisation → 3ds Max + V-Ray/Corona (with budget and a specialist) or Blender (on a tight budget)
  • Bespoke furniture, non-standard pieces → Fusion 360: CAD + CAM in one, no unnecessary overhead
  • Interior designer needing fast presentation → SketchUp + Enscape: intuitive, results in hours

No single program does everything equally well. Most medium and large manufacturers run two or three tools in combination: production CAD → visualisation → project management.
